Leighland Christian School – Ulverstone TAS

“A hope filled Christian community pioneering personalised real-world education”

Leighland Christian School is a thriving, community-centred non-denominational, independent Christian School of approximately 680+ students, with a K-6 Campus at Burnie and a K-12 Campus at Ulverstone.

The Executive Principal invites Expressions of Interest from motivated Christian educators to join our team in 2026.

HEAD OF SPORT K-12 Ulverstone Campus

1.0FTE

(includes teaching load of 0.5FTE)

2026 start

The successful applicant/s will be responsible for:

Leading and coordinating the NSATIS (Northern Sports Association Tasmanian Independent Schools) program

Co‑ordinating the K-12 Sporting Carnivals

Collaborating and positively contributing to the teaching and learning culture of the School

Strengthening home/school partnerships where parents' support is valued and encouraged to improve learning opportunities and outcomes for students

Implementing a hands‑on curriculum based on the Australian Curriculum that invites students’ exploration and reflects a commitment to personalised learning

Outstanding classroom practice and comprehensive experience using Information Technology within a teaching and learning program

Fostering and maintaining the wellbeing of students in a Christian education environment

The successful applicant/s will have:

Proven commitment to Christian faith, including active/regular involvement in a church

A good understanding of and commitment to the mission and philosophy of the School

Well‑developed inter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to interact effectively with a range of school community members

A commitment to the provision of equal opportunity in education for all students

Current Tasmanian Teacher’s Registration (or the ability to obtain one)

A current Working with Vulnerable People card

A recent written reference from a pastor/minister
